It’s a repeat of Ajagajantharam this year for Malayalam actor Antony Varghese! The actor, who was recently seen in the children’s fantasy sports-drama Aanaparambile World Cup, has another release scheduled later this month with the romantic comedy – Oh Meri Laila.

The film, which is helmed by his college mate and friend Abhishek KS, is writted by Anuraj OB and is set to hit theatres as a Christmas release. Antony took to his social media page to announce when the film will hit theatres.

“Giving a break to action and stunt, we are coming this Christmas to celebrate… Last year on December 23 Ajagajantharam released and this year, it will be Oh Meri Laila,” wrote the actor, sharing a poster from the movie that has him in two different avatars.

The film will have Sona Olickal, who played the female protagonist in Shane Nigam’s Veyil earlier this year, as its heroine along with debutante Nandhana Raja. The movie also has Nandu and Senthil Krishna in pivotal roles. Antony plays the role of a youngster named Lailasuran in the movie.

Meanwhile, Antony has also completed shooting for the comedy entertainer Poovan, which is helmed by Super Sharanya actor Vineeth Vasudevan. The movie is expected to be released in theatres early next year. The team, we hear, is also in discussions with ZEE5 for its OTT rights.

In an earlier interview with us, Vineeth said, “Antony has previously essayed a lot of angry characters. Compared to those films, this will be a simple entertainer. It also has a Christmas backdrop. The movie doesn’t just revolve around his character; it tells the story of those in his neighbourhood.”

Antony is also teaming up with Tinu Pappachan for the third time, in the latter’s directorial Chaaver, which is scripted by Joy Mathew and has Kunchacko Boban and Arjun Ashokan in the lead roles.
